Responsibilities:

• Participates in the screening, evaluation, and care of inmates while under the supervision of a physician and/or registered nurse.

• Record patients’ medical information and vital signs.

• Prepare patients for and assist with examinations or treatments.

• Prepare rooms, sterile instruments, equipment, or supplies and ensure that stock of supplies is maintained.

• Coordinate with other medical and ancillary personnel, as required, to ensure continuity of care.

• Monitor, record, and report symptoms or changes in patients’ condition.

• Provide appropriate nursing interventions in emergency situations.

• Comply with all state requirements and facility policies and procedures.
